ca.infoway.messagebuilder.model.pcs_mr2007_v02_r01.common.merged
Class DosagePreconditionsBean

Package class diagram package DosagePreconditionsBean
java.lang.Object
  extended by ca.infoway.messagebuilder.model.MessagePartBean
      extended by ca.infoway.messagebuilder.model.pcs_mr2007_v02_r01.common.merged.DosagePreconditionsBean
All Implemented Interfaces:
NullFlavorSupport, Serializable

public class DosagePreconditionsBean
extends MessagePartBean

Business Name: DosagePreconditions

COCT_MT260030CA.ObservationEventCriterion: Dosage Preconditions

Allows recommended dosage instructions to be bound to a particular characteristic of the patient.

A condition that must be true for the patient in order for the specified recommended dosage range to apply.

COCT_MT260010CA.ObservationEventCriterion: Dosage Preconditions

Allows recommended dosage instructions to be bound to a particular characteristic of the patient.

A condition that must be true for the patient in order for the specified recommended dosage range to apply.

COCT_MT260020CA.ObservationEventCriterion: Dosage Preconditions

Allows recommended dosage instructions to be bound to a particular characteristic of the patient.

A condition that must be true for the patient in order for the specified recommended dosage range to apply.

See Also:
Serialized Form

Constructor Summary
DosagePreconditionsBean()
           
 
Method Summary
 ObservationDosageDefinitionPreconditionType getCode()
          Business Name: DosagePreconditionType
 UncertainRange<PhysicalQuantity> getValue()
          Business Name: DosagePreconditionValue
 void setCode(ObservationDosageDefinitionPreconditionType code)
          Business Name: DosagePreconditionType
 void setValue(UncertainRange<PhysicalQuantity> value)
          Business Name: DosagePreconditionValue
 
Methods inherited from class ca.infoway.messagebuilder.model.MessagePartBean
getField, getNullFlavor, getNullFlavor, getSpecializationType, hasNullFlavor, hasNullFlavor, setNullFlavor, setNullFlavor, setSpecializationType
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DosagePreconditionsBean

public DosagePreconditionsBean()
Method Detail

getCode

public ObservationDosageDefinitionPreconditionType getCode()

Business Name: DosagePreconditionType

Un-merged Business Name: DosagePreconditionType

Relationship: COCT_MT260030CA.ObservationEventCriterion.code

Conformance/Cardinality: MANDATORY (1)

Allows the specification of multiple preconditions for a dosage specification, such as Age Range, Weight Range, etc. This is mandatory because the precondition range cannot be evaluated without knowing the precondition type.

Indicates the type of characteristic against which the patient is evaluated. This includes age, weight, height, etc.

Un-merged Business Name: DosagePreconditionType

Relationship: COCT_MT260010CA.ObservationEventCriterion.code

Conformance/Cardinality: MANDATORY (1)

Allows the specification of multiple preconditions for a dosage specification, such as Age Range, Weight Range, etc. This is mandatory because the precondition range cannot be evaluated without knowing the precondition type.

Indicates the type of characteristic against which the patient is evaluated. This includes age, weight, height, etc.

Un-merged Business Name: DosagePreconditionType

Relationship: COCT_MT260020CA.ObservationEventCriterion.code

Conformance/Cardinality: MANDATORY (1)

Allows the specification of multiple preconditions for a dosage specification, such as Age Range, Weight Range, etc. This is mandatory because the precondition range cannot be evaluated without knowing the precondition type.

Indicates the type of characteristic against which the patient is evaluated. This includes age, weight, height, etc.


setCode

public void setCode(ObservationDosageDefinitionPreconditionType code)

Business Name: DosagePreconditionType

Un-merged Business Name: DosagePreconditionType

Relationship: COCT_MT260030CA.ObservationEventCriterion.code

Conformance/Cardinality: MANDATORY (1)

Allows the specification of multiple preconditions for a dosage specification, such as Age Range, Weight Range, etc. This is mandatory because the precondition range cannot be evaluated without knowing the precondition type.

Indicates the type of characteristic against which the patient is evaluated. This includes age, weight, height, etc.

Un-merged Business Name: DosagePreconditionType

Relationship: COCT_MT260010CA.ObservationEventCriterion.code

Conformance/Cardinality: MANDATORY (1)

Allows the specification of multiple preconditions for a dosage specification, such as Age Range, Weight Range, etc. This is mandatory because the precondition range cannot be evaluated without knowing the precondition type.

Indicates the type of characteristic against which the patient is evaluated. This includes age, weight, height, etc.

Un-merged Business Name: DosagePreconditionType

Relationship: COCT_MT260020CA.ObservationEventCriterion.code

Conformance/Cardinality: MANDATORY (1)

Allows the specification of multiple preconditions for a dosage specification, such as Age Range, Weight Range, etc. This is mandatory because the precondition range cannot be evaluated without knowing the precondition type.

Indicates the type of characteristic against which the patient is evaluated. This includes age, weight, height, etc.


getValue

public UncertainRange<PhysicalQuantity> getValue()

Business Name: DosagePreconditionValue

Un-merged Business Name: DosagePreconditionValue

Relationship: COCT_MT260030CA.ObservationEventCriterion.value

Conformance/Cardinality: MANDATORY (1)

Minimum Age

Maximum Age

Allows direct comparison of the patient's characteristics with the minimum and maximum values specified.

The element is mandatory because there's no point in identifying that the dosage range is based on criteria unless the specific criterion used is expressed.

If not specified, it means that the range is based on a criteria (e.g. weight), but the specific range on which the criteria is based is not known.

A specific value or range of values of the Dosage Precondition Type, for which the recommended dosage applies.

This includes min-max age range, min-max weights, etc.

This is a mandatory attribute as the specific range of values must be known.

Un-merged Business Name: DosagePreconditionValue

Relationship: COCT_MT260010CA.ObservationEventCriterion.value

Conformance/Cardinality: MANDATORY (1)

Minimum Age

Maximum Age

Allows direct comparison of the patient's characteristics with the minimum and maximum values specified.

The element is mandatory because there's no point in identifying that the dosage range is based on criteria unless the specific criterion used is expressed.

If not specified, it means that the range is based on a criteria (e.g. weight), but the specific range on which the criteria is based is not known.

A specific value or range of values of the Dosage Precondition Type, for which the recommended dosage applies.

This includes min-max age range, min-max weights, etc.

This is a mandatory attribute as the values of the measurements must be known.

Un-merged Business Name: DosagePreconditionValue

Relationship: COCT_MT260020CA.ObservationEventCriterion.value

Conformance/Cardinality: MANDATORY (1)

Minimum Age

Maximum Age

Allows direct comparison of the patient's characteristics with the minimum and maximum values specified.

The element is mandatory because there's no point in identifying that the dosage range is based on criteria unless the specific criterion used is expressed.

If not specified, it means that the range is based on a criteria (e.g. weight), but the specific range on which the criteria is based is not known.

A specific value or range of values of the Dosage Precondition Type, for which the recommended dosage applies.

This includes min-max age range, min-max weights, etc.

This attribute is mandatory as the specific range of values must be known.


setValue

public void setValue(UncertainRange<PhysicalQuantity> value)

Business Name: DosagePreconditionValue

Un-merged Business Name: DosagePreconditionValue

Relationship: COCT_MT260030CA.ObservationEventCriterion.value

Conformance/Cardinality: MANDATORY (1)

Minimum Age

Maximum Age

Allows direct comparison of the patient's characteristics with the minimum and maximum values specified.

The element is mandatory because there's no point in identifying that the dosage range is based on criteria unless the specific criterion used is expressed.

If not specified, it means that the range is based on a criteria (e.g. weight), but the specific range on which the criteria is based is not known.

A specific value or range of values of the Dosage Precondition Type, for which the recommended dosage applies.

This includes min-max age range, min-max weights, etc.

This is a mandatory attribute as the specific range of values must be known.

Un-merged Business Name: DosagePreconditionValue

Relationship: COCT_MT260010CA.ObservationEventCriterion.value

Conformance/Cardinality: MANDATORY (1)

Minimum Age

Maximum Age

Allows direct comparison of the patient's characteristics with the minimum and maximum values specified.

The element is mandatory because there's no point in identifying that the dosage range is based on criteria unless the specific criterion used is expressed.

If not specified, it means that the range is based on a criteria (e.g. weight), but the specific range on which the criteria is based is not known.

A specific value or range of values of the Dosage Precondition Type, for which the recommended dosage applies.

This includes min-max age range, min-max weights, etc.

This is a mandatory attribute as the values of the measurements must be known.

Un-merged Business Name: DosagePreconditionValue

Relationship: COCT_MT260020CA.ObservationEventCriterion.value

Conformance/Cardinality: MANDATORY (1)

Minimum Age

Maximum Age

Allows direct comparison of the patient's characteristics with the minimum and maximum values specified.

The element is mandatory because there's no point in identifying that the dosage range is based on criteria unless the specific criterion used is expressed.

If not specified, it means that the range is based on a criteria (e.g. weight), but the specific range on which the criteria is based is not known.

A specific value or range of values of the Dosage Precondition Type, for which the recommended dosage applies.

This includes min-max age range, min-max weights, etc.

This attribute is mandatory as the specific range of values must be known.



Copyright © 2013. All Rights Reserved.